Relative abundances of bacterial taxa across all 324 samples. Circular stacked bar chart showing the bacterial relative abundances of all the samples in the study cohort (n=324), divided based on parity – no previous pregnancies or deliveries (nulliparous) (n=188) and one or more previous deliveries (multiparous) (n=136). The samples have been ordered based on two criteria 1) gestational age in weeks, increasing clockwise (outer band) and 2) within each gestational age bracket, whether one of the top 3 bacteria were the most abundant (>50% composition), ordered clockwise from None, to Gardnerella vaginalis, Lactobacillus iners, and Lactobacillus crispatus dominant samples.
